はじめに

2025年4月4日、Vultr社は同社のContainer Registryサービスに関する重要なアップデートを発表しました。クラウドネイティブなアプリケーション展開においてコンテナレジストリは中核的な役割を担っており、今回のアップデートは特にグローバル展開を行う企業や開発チームにとって注目すべき内容となっています。本記事では、2025年4月時点での新ロケーション情報と機能強化について詳細に記録します。
新たに追加されたデータセンターロケーション
2025年4月時点での対応地域一覧
Vultr Container Registryは、以下の11のグローバルデータセンターリージョンで利用可能となりました:
ヨーロッパ地域
- Amsterdam(アムステルダム): オランダの主要なクラウドハブとして、ヨーロッパ西部をカバー
- Frankfurt(フランクフルト): ドイツの金融・技術中心地として、中央ヨーロッパへの最適化されたアクセスを提供
- London(ロンドン): 英国市場およびヨーロッパ北西部への戦略的拠点
北米地域
- Chicago(シカゴ): 米国中西部の主要ハブとして、内陸部への低レイテンシーアクセスを実現
- Los Angeles(ロサンゼルス): 米国西海岸および太平洋地域への玄関口
- Seattle(シアトル): 米国北西部およびカナダ西部市場をカバー
アジア太平洋地域
- Bangalore(バンガロール): インドのテクノロジーハブとして、南アジア市場への戦略的展開
- Seoul(ソウル): 韓国市場および東アジア北部への最適化されたサービス提供
- Singapore(シンガポール): 東南アジア全域への中核拠点
- Sydney(シドニー): オーストラリア・ニュージーランド市場への対応
- Tokyo(東京): 日本市場および東アジア地域への重要な接続点
ロケーション選択の戦略的意義
これらの新ロケーションは、コンテナイメージをエンドユーザーにより近い場所に保存することで、レイテンシーの大幅な削減を実現します。特に動的スケーリングが必要なワークロードにおいて、アプリケーションの迅速なデプロイメントと最適なパフォーマンスが保証されます。
地理的分散により、以下の利点が得られます:
レイテンシー最適化: 各地域のデータセンターから直接コンテナイメージを取得することで、ネットワーク遅延を最小化 可用性向上: 複数リージョンでの冗長性により、単一障害点の排除を実現 コンプライアンス対応: データ主権要件やローカライゼーション規制への準拠が容易
Docker Hub プロキシキャッシュの導入
レート制限の解決
今回のアップデートで最も注目すべき機能の一つが、Docker Hub プロキシキャッシュの実装です。この機能により、パブリックコンテナイメージの取得時にレート制限による中断が発生することがなくなりました。
従来の課題として、Docker Hub の無料アカウントでは時間あたりのプル回数に制限があり、CI/CDパイプラインや大規模なデプロイメント時に頻繁な制限に直面していました。Vultr Container Registry のプロキシキャッシュは、この問題を根本的に解決します。
認証とローカルキャッシュの仕組み
プロキシキャッシュシステムは以下の仕組みで動作します:
認証処理: Vultr のクレデンシャルを使用してDocker Hub へのアクセスを管理 ローカルキャッシュ: 一度取得したイメージは Vultr のインフラ内にキャッシュされ、後続のリクエストで再利用 透過的な処理: 既存のDocker ワークフローを変更することなく、自動的にプロキシ経由でアクセス
これにより、開発チームはレート制限を意識することなく、必要なパブリックイメージを自由に取得できるようになりました。
Vultr API の機能拡張
新しい管理機能
Container Registry の運用効率を向上させるため、Vultr API に以下の新機能が追加されました:
ユーザー管理機能
Container Registry ユーザーの作成、編集、削除をプログラマティックに実行可能となりました。これにより、チームメンバーの追加や権限管理を自動化できます。
アクセス制御の強化
VCR(Vultr Container Registry)キーの交換機能により、セキュリティポリシーに応じた定期的な認証情報の更新が可能です。なるほど、これは企業のセキュリティガバナンス要件に対応する重要な機能といえます。
レポジトリレプリケーション
リポジトリの複製機能により、複数のリージョン間でのシームレスな配布が実現されます。これにより、グローバル展開時の一貫性とパフォーマンスが保証されます。
アーティファクト管理の効率化
不要なアーティファクトの削除機能が改善され、ストレージコストの最適化と管理の簡素化が実現されています。
API 統合の実践例
新しいAPI機能は、既存のDevOpsワークフローに容易に統合できます:
# ユーザー作成の例
curl -X POST https://api.vultr.com/v2/registry/users \
-H "Authorization: Bearer $VULTR_API_KEY" \
-H "Content-Type: application/json" \
-d '{"username": "team-member", "permissions": ["read", "write"]}'
# レポジトリレプリケーション
curl -X POST https://api.vultr.com/v2/registry/repositories/replicate \
-H "Authorization: Bearer $VULTR_API_KEY" \
-d '{"source_region": "tokyo", "target_regions": ["singapore", "sydney"]}'
クラウドネイティブアプリケーションにおける活用
Vultr Kubernetes Engine との統合
Vultr Container Registry は、同社のKubernetes Engine(VKE)とのネイティブな統合を提供します。これにより、コンテナイメージの保存から Kubernetes クラスターでのデプロイメントまでを一貫したワークフローで実行できます。
特にAIモデルの展開において、Cloud GPU インスタンスと組み合わせることで、高性能な機械学習ワークロードの迅速なデプロイメントが可能です。
Apache Kafka Connect との連携
データストリーミングアプリケーションにおいて、Apache Kafka Connect のコネクターイメージを Vultr Container Registry で管理することで、データパイプラインの構築と運用が効率化されます。
複数のデータソースから Kafka クラスターへのリアルタイムデータ取り込みにおいて、コンテナベースのアプローチは柔軟性と拡張性を提供します。
セキュリティとガバナンス
プライベートレジストリのメリット
Vultr Container Registry をプライベートレジストリとして使用することで、以下のセキュリティ上の利点が得られます:
アクセス制御: 組織内の承認されたユーザーのみがイメージにアクセス可能 脆弱性スキャン: 統合されたセキュリティスキャン機能による自動的な脆弱性検出 監査証跡: すべてのアクセスとデプロイメントの完全なログ記録
コンプライアンス対応
新しいグローバルロケーションにより、データ保護規制(GDPR、CCPA等)への準拠が容易になりました。特に、データの地理的制約がある業界において、適切なリージョン選択によりコンプライアンス要件を満たすことができます。
パフォーマンス最適化のベストプラクティス
イメージサイズの最適化
Container Registry を効果的に活用するため、以下のイメージ最適化手法を推奨します:
マルチステージビルド: 不要なビルドツールを最終イメージから除外 ベースイメージの選択: Alpine Linux 等の軽量ディストリビューションの使用 レイヤーキャッシュの活用: Docker レイヤーの再利用によるビルド時間の短縮
ネットワーク最適化
各リージョンのContainer Registry を活用することで、以下の最適化が可能です:
イメージプル時間の短縮: 地理的に近いレジストリからの取得 帯域幅コストの削減: リージョン内でのデータ転送によるコスト最適化 可用性の向上: 複数リージョンでの冗長化による障害耐性
運用上の考慮事項
移行戦略
既存のContainer Registryソリューションから Vultr への移行を検討する際は、以下の段階的アプローチを推奨します:
- 評価フェーズ: 現在のイメージサイズ、プル頻度、地理的分散要件の分析
- パイロット導入: 非本番環境での機能検証とパフォーマンステスト
- 段階的移行: 重要度の低いアプリケーションから順次移行
- 本格運用: 本番ワークロードの完全移行と運用プロセスの確立
コスト管理
Container Registry の運用コストを最適化するため、以下の戦略を検討します:
イメージライフサイクル管理: 不要な古いイメージの定期的な削除 リージョン戦略: 実際の利用パターンに基づく適切なリージョン選択 キャッシュ効率の最大化: 頻繁にアクセスされるイメージのローカルキャッシュ活用
今後の展望
技術的進歩への対応
コンテナエコシステムの進化に伴い、Vultr Container Registry も継続的な機能拡張が期待されます。特に以下の領域での発展が注目されます:
OCI仕様への完全対応: Open Container Initiative 標準への準拠強化 セキュリティ機能の拡充: より高度な脆弱性スキャンと脅威検出機能 統合エコシステムの拡大: より多くのクラウドネイティブツールとの連携
エッジコンピューティングへの対応
5G通信の普及とエッジコンピューティングの拡大に伴い、より分散化されたContainer Registry の需要が高まることが予想されます。Vultr の地理的分散戦略は、この動向に適切に対応していると評価できます。
まとめ
2025年4月のVultr Container Registry アップデートは、グローバルなクラウドインフラストラクチャーの競争において重要な一歩を示しています。11の新しいデータセンターロケーションによる地理的分散、Docker Hub プロキシキャッシュによるレート制限の解決、そして強化されたAPI機能により、現代的なコンテナワークロードの要求に対応する包括的なソリューションが提供されています。
特に注目すべきは、単なる機能追加ではなく、実際の運用課題を解決する実用的なアプローチを取っている点です。レイテンシーの削減、運用の自動化、セキュリティの強化という、企業のデジタルトランスフォーメーションにおいて必要不可欠な要素が統合されています。
クラウドネイティブアプリケーションの普及が加速する中で、Vultr Container Registry の今回のアップデートは、開発チームがより効率的で信頼性の高いコンテナ基盤を構築するための重要な選択肢となるでしょう。今後の更なる機能拡張と、エコシステムとの統合の進展に継続的な注目が必要です。